| My wife closed out her IRA early. That would normally have a 10% penalty, but our medical expenses in excess 7.5% of our income exceeds the amount of the IRA, so there is no penalty, right? TaxCut asks for the "incorrect exclusion amount" without defining it. I am guessing that it means the amount in excess of my medical over 7.5% of my income. But that is just a guess. Anyone know.
